加载中…
个人资料
  • 博客等级:
  • 博客积分:
  • 博客访问:
  • 关注人气:
  • 获赠金笔:0支
  • 赠出金笔:0支
  • 荣誉徽章:
正文 字体大小:

PLC编程实例之条码图

(2015-08-14 15:42:41)
标签:

plc编程实例

三菱plc

西门子plc

plc编程

    在电路的控制中,在改变电路的数据时,用如图291所示的条形囹显示数据。具有

直观清楚的效果。图中有16个发光二机管,初始时有8个发光二极管亮,按动减按钮,

减少条形图的发先长度;按动加按钮,增加条形图的发光长度。

http://sucimg.itc.cn/sblog/jf13e948db9ab26d5f98b0cf063c7f8a7 

 

控制方案设计

1. 输入/输出元件及控制功能

如表291所示,介绍了实29中用到的输入/输出元件及控制功能。

http://sucimg.itc.cn/sblog/j821c0a8c4895493f3ba6bf2bbec01c85 

 

2. 电路设计

条码图控制PLC接线图如图292所示,梯形图如图293所示。

http://sucimg.itc.cn/sblog/j50b0ebca206c7586152796428432755b

3. 控制原理

十进制数K255等于二进制数0000000011111111PLC运行时初始化脉冲M8002产生一个脉冲,将常数 K255传送到 K4Y0,结果 Y7Y0得电,发光二极管 HL1HL8得电发光。

PLC运行时,M8000lM80010

按下加按钮X0,执行左移指令SRTLP,原数据0000000011111111左移一位,M80001传送给最忘端的低位Y0,移位的结果为K4Y0000000011111111Y10Y0得电。

如果按下减按钮X1,执行右移指令SFTRP,原数据0000000011111111右移一位,M80010传送给左端的最高位Y17,移位的结果为K4Y00000000011111111Y6Y0得电。条码图控制原理图如图294所示。

http://sucimg.itc.cn/sblog/ja7fbfb92309c55a4497659cb19f9b54a 

http://sucimg.itc.cn/sblog/jef23af0684731e1423fadd369877fff9

0

阅读 收藏 喜欢 打印举报/Report
  

新浪BLOG意见反馈留言板 欢迎批评指正

新浪简介 | About Sina | 广告服务 | 联系我们 | 招聘信息 | 网站律师 | SINA English | 产品答疑

新浪公司 版权所有